Tree Trimming Services in November for a Healthy Landscape


As the vibrant colors of autumn fade away, November marks the prelude to the wintry months ahead. Amidst the hustle and bustle of the season's preparations, it's crucial not to overlook the well-being of the trees that grace our landscapes. At Keller Commercial and Home Services, we understand the significance of timely tree care, especially with the winter approaching. Our professional tree trimming services not only enhance the aesthetic appeal of your property but also ensure the safety and health of your trees, thereby safeguarding your surroundings from potential hazards during turbulent weather conditions.

Ensuring Safety and Preventing Hazards


Neglecting the maintenance of trees can pose significant risks, particularly during the unpredictable storms that accompany the winter season. Unhealthy branches, susceptible to breakage under heavy snow or strong winds, can transform into hazardous projectiles. Our diligent team of experts is equipped to identify and eliminate such risks, effectively minimizing potential dangers that could harm your property or endanger the well-being of those around you.


Promoting Health and Growth


Our professional approach to tree care not only prioritizes safety but also focuses on the overall health and longevity of your trees. Through strategic trimming and pruning, we stimulate healthy growth, allowing your trees to flourish with renewed vitality. By eliminating diseased or overgrown branches, we facilitate increased sunlight exposure and air circulation, fostering an environment conducive to robust and vibrant tree development.


Pest Prevention and Enhanced Appeal


Neglecting the maintenance of trees can inadvertently invite the intrusion of pests and diseases, ultimately compromising the well-being of your landscape. Our comprehensive tree trimming services act as a proactive measure, preventing the onset of infestations and diseases that can weaken your trees over time. Furthermore, our meticulous approach contributes to the visual appeal of your surroundings, ensuring that your landscape remains an inviting and aesthetically pleasing sanctuary throughout the winter months and beyond.

Mulch is that essential layer of material spread on top of soil in garden beds, around trees, or over landscaped areas. Not only does it enhance the appearance of your landscape, but it also improves soil health and conserves moisture. In this post, we explore the benefits of mulching, especially during winter, as well as the importance of tree trimming during this time of year. The Benefits of Mulching As an organic material, mulch gradually breaks down, releasing essential nutrients such as n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ium into the soil. This process improves soil fertility and supports healthy plant growth. Additionally, mulch creates a moist, nutrient-rich environment that attracts earthworms. These helpful creatures aerate the soil and deposit nutrient-rich castings as they burrow and digest organic matter. To maintain these benefits, it’s essential to reapply mulch every 1 to 2 years, ensuring a thickness of 2 to 4 inches. Too much mulch can suffocate plant roots and trap excess moisture, while too little may not provide adequate coverage. While winters in Texas are milder compared to many other states, sudden freezes are common. Mulch can act as a protective layer, helping insulate pipes, drip lines, and plants from temperature fluctuations, reducing the risk of freeze damage. Why Winter is Ideal for Tree Trimming Winter is also an excellent time to trim trees, especially species like live oaks and red oaks. Pruning these trees during winter minimizes the risk of spreading oak wilt, a deadly disease. During winter, most trees are dormant, meaning their growth slows down, and many pests and diseases that can harm trees are inactive. Trimming trees during this time allows wounds to heal more effectively, directing their energy into producing healthy new growth in spring. Proper trimming also improves a tree’s overall structure and vitality, preparing it for the growing season. Another significant benefit of winter tree trimming is the reduced risk of storm damage. Removing weak or overgrown branches in advance minimizes the chances of these limbs breaking during storms and causing harm to people, vehicles, or buildings. By trimming trees in winter, you ensure that hazardous limbs are removed before they can fall. Final Thoughts Mulching and tree trimming are essential practices that enhance the health and appearance of your landscape, especially during winter. By taking these steps, you can protect your garden and trees, ensuring they thrive in the coming growing season.
